Integrated Microwave Oven
Microwave ovens make it easier to meal preparation and can be integrated into a kitchen's design to create a seamless look. You can integrate microwaves into cabinets, install them on islands, or even recess them into walls.
Built-in microwaves have stylish design and easy access however you'll need take care to measure your space to ensure the model will fit properly.

Safety features
Microwave ovens make use of electromagnetic radiation from the microwave spectrum of the radio spectrum to cook and heat food items. This radiation induces the polar molecules present in food to vibrate and produce thermal energy. This process is called dielectric heating. Microwave ovens are able to defrost food and beverages without heating, unlike conventional ovens. It is crucial to follow the directions on how to use your microwave.
When you are choosing a new microwave oven, look for one that has an option for child safety to stop children from accidentally activating the appliance or opening it while it is operating. This reduces the chance of accidents resulting in burns or injuries. Certain models have interlocking switches that prevent microwave radiation until the door has been closed. Some also have cool-touch doors and control panels to reduce the chance of burns.
Some consumers are concerned about radiation exposure from microwaves however, the FDA declares that microwaves are not an health risk if a user is not directly in the oven's vicinity while it is operating. However, the agency has received reports of microwaves that continue to emit radiation even when the door is closed. In this case the user should stop using the microwave as soon as possible.
Certain models have the padlock feature that locks the buttons on the control panel to avoid accidental operation. This feature is particularly useful for families with children that are small. It is a great way to keep children from accidentally activating the microwave and sparking fires or causing other problems.

While most home fires are caused by cooking equipment however, only 4 percent are caused by microwave ovens. These appliances aren't typically the cause of fires in homes but they can cause serious injuries and damage. Most microwave fires occur because of clogged vents. Overheating and improper use are among the main causes.
Cooking modes
A microwave oven is equipped with different cooking modes to meet the particular requirements of your kitchen. These be anything from microwave cooking that is basic to convection grilling and baking. These options are more flexible than traditional cooking options and are perfect to reheat or defrost. These cooking options can also enhance the quality of your food.
Depending on the model you choose the microwave will include a small metal rack, a high metal rack, or a glass turntable. These accessories can be used to cook a broad variety of food items, such as brownies and cakes. The majority of these gadgets come with a non-stick interior that resists stains and splatters, making them easier to clean. Certain models also come with a removable lid that helps to prevent spills.
A microwave/oven combination is another option. These units combine the functions of a microwave oven and an oven in one unit. They are perfect for small kitchens. They also allow you to grill your food and then brown it by using the oven's powerful airflow, resulting in delicious meals. They can also be used to bake and roast.
These models are usually designed to fit in your cabinets, with a few flush installation options available to give seamless appearance. They are installed at a level that is comfortable, they can be used conjunction with wall-mounted ovens to help you move dishes. There are models with a built-in trim kit that will ensure that they are seamlessly integrated into the rest of your kitchen design.
Microwaves are available in a variety of sizes and shapes and shapes, so it's crucial to select the right one for your kitchen. The key is to decide whether you'll use it for cooking basic meals or for more elaborate meals. If you want to use it for baking, then you'll have to select a larger model.
If you are planning to do lots of baking and roasting you should consider a convection microwave that is a combination. These appliances combine the power and speed of a microwavable with the precision of an oven. This can save you significant time.
Energy efficiency
Microwave technology is a reliable method of cooking food and reducing energy consumption. It also allows you to cut down on electricity bills. Many models feature an eco mode to help consumers conserve energy. Certain models come with a timer that automatically shuts the microwave off after cooking is complete.
Microwave ovens use electromagnetic waves to heat water molecules that make up food. The process is carried out in a circular chamber inside the oven, which is known as a magnetron. The magnetron utilizes an electrical current of high-speed to produce electromagnetic waves of low frequency. The resulting waves penetrate the food, causing them to vibrate and absorb energy from molecules around them. The vibrations cause the water molecules to heat and evaporate, thus heating the food.
Microwave ovens are now a hot topic. New models are equipped with eco modes that help users save energy and reduce costs. Energy-saving features include sensors and displays that show cooking times and the ability to select the power level. Some models come with presets for various foods. Some microwaves are able to weigh food items to determine the right power level and cooking time required.
While the majority of the latest features in these ovens are designed to make them more user-friendly to use, some have drawbacks. Some of these appliances, for example, use a large amount of electricity in standby mode. These devices can also emit harmful gases. These concerns are being addressed by various manufacturers that use more efficient circuits and have developed new types of insulation within the cavity.
The most modern microwaves use sensors to boost their energy efficiency. Sensors detect moisture levels in the oven and adjust the power output according to prevent over or undercooking. They also ensure that food is cooked evenly. These innovative features have become increasingly popular and can save the consumer money as well as enhance the kitchen.
